Hays Medical Center hosts Journeys and Destinations event

Hays Medical Center is hosting a health and science career exploration day called Journeys and Destinations on Nov. 22 from 9 a.m. to 2 p.m.

There will be sessions for different fields and medical careers, as well as a guest speaker session presented by M.D. Larry Watts.

Guidance counselor Suellyn Stenger had the pleasure of attending this event with students last year.

“Students can choose from a wide variety of break-out sessions that involve some hands on activities,” Stenger said. “The Chief Medical Officer for Hays Med does a great job of presenting up-to-date information in an easy-to-understand format.”

Junior Becky Meagher attended Journeys and Destinations last year and thought the experience was incredible.

“I was very nervous at first but from the moment you got there you were learning in a fun way,” Meagher said. “Every station we went to had hands on activities and ways of learning about each occupation.  All of the workers were very good about answering any questions we had and finding a way to explain the information in ways we could understand.”

The deadline for registering to attend is Wednesday, Nov. 13, and the cost is $5 per student.

For students interested in medical careers, this event can be really informative and motivational.

“This is a wonderful opportunity for students who are interested in exploring careers in the fields of health and science,” Stenger said.
